Bex Bagnato

Bex Bagnato, MA, currently lives and works in New Jersey as a mental health care manager for youth with behavioral challenges, with a focus on LGBTQ+ youth. They have a masters in child advocacy and policy and bachelors in psychology, with research on LGBTQ+ youth and suicide prevention. Bex has taught LGBTQ+ introductory workshops and other mental health-based workshops in colleges and local conferences and has been a guest speaker with the New Jersey chapter of the National Alliance on Mental Illness. From an early age they have had a passion to educate people on the social justice and mental health issues particular to the LGBTQ+ community. They have been singing in ANNA Crusis for the last four years and is a member of the board of directors. When Bex is not working or singing in ANNA they enjoy playing softball, spending time with their partner and their 3 cats. Bex is and uses the identification terms of demiboy, transmasculine and non-binary. Their pronouns are they/them or he/him.
